Bedi defends appointing nominated MLAs in Pondy Assembly

Pondicherry Lieutenant Governor Kiran Bedi has defended her last year’s appointment of nominated MLAs to Pondicherry Legislative Assembly.

The Centre had earlier recommended the names of Pondicherry BJP leader Saminathan, treasurer Shankar and Selvaganapathy, trustee of Vivekananda Group of Educational Institutions, as the three nominated MLAs in the Assembly.  However, Congress chief-minister Narayanaswamy was not in agreement on the issue and opposed the nomination of the trio.

Bedi administered the oath of office and secrecy to the trio as nominated MLAs in July last year which was contested by the Pondicherry Government which moved the High Court of Madras in this regard.

When the case came up for hearing today, the Court ruled in Bedi’s favour and said that the appointments were done in the right manner. Reacting to the verdict, Bedi remarked that the MLAs were appointed based only on the provisions in the Constitution of India.
